Use the right inputs

Use figures from the same time period and the same cost definition. Required inputs on this calculator are Labor cost, Travel/vehicle cost, Replacement materials, Other cost. If an amount already includes overhead or employer burden, do not add the same cost again elsewhere.

How to interpret the result

The result is decision support, not a universal target. Recalculate whenever labor, material or scope assumptions change before the customer accepts the quote. A change in one assumption can materially change the answer, especially when margin or billable utilization is involved.

Common mistake

Markup and margin are not the same percentage, and confusing them produces systematically underpriced work.
